| Properties of Plasma Sprayed Al2O3-13TiO2 and ZrO2
Blended Coatings on Biomedical Alloy |

| Abstract |
| Plasma spray grade Al2O3-13TiO2 and ZrO2 powders were blended physically in different
proportions (80 wt% Al2O3-13TiO2 + 20 wt% ZrO2, 20 wt% Al2O3-13TiO2 + 80 wt% ZrO2
and 50 wt% Al2O3-13TiO2 + 50 wt% ZrO2) and plasma sprayed on biomedical
Ti-13Nb-13Zr alloy using identical plasma spray parameters. Microstructural and phase
analyses of the as-sprayed coatings were carried out using scanning electron
microscopy and X-ray diffractometry. Results showed that the 80% Al2O3-13TiO2 +
20% ZrO2 coating had enhanced corrosion and wear resistance compared to the other
two compositions and appeared to be a propitious coating for biomedical application.
[Keywords: Plasma spray, Hardness, Corrosion, Wear, Microstructure] |
